00038 #ifndef POINT2DT_H_DEFINED
00039 #define POINT2DT_H_DEFINED
00040 
00041 #include "Image/Point2D.H"
00042 #include "Util/SimTime.H"
00043 
00044 //! This is a fairly trivial (i, j, t) set representing a timestamped Point2D<int>.
00045 /*! This class is an open (all members public) container for a Point2D<int>
00046 and a time stamp. Like Point2D<int>, this class is fully inlined, so there
00047 is no Point2DT.C file. */
00048 
00049 class Point2DT
00050 {
00051 public:
00052   //! Default contructor, initializes to zeros
00053   inline Point2DT() : p(0, 0), t(SimTime::ZERO()) { };
00054 
00055   //! Constructor given a Point2D<int> and time
00056   inline Point2DT(const Point2D<int>& pp, const SimTime& tt) : p(pp), t(tt) { };
00057 
00058   //! Constructor given (i, j) and time
00059   inline Point2DT(const int i, const int j,
00060                   const SimTime& tt) : p(i, j), t(tt) { };
00061 
00062   //! returns true if coordinates are not (-1, -1)
00063   inline bool isValid() const;
00064 
00065 
00066   Point2D<int> p;  //!< The spatial coordinates
00067   SimTime t;  //!< The time, in seconds
00068 };
00069 
00070 // ######################################################################
00071 // #################### INLINED METHODS:
00072 // ######################################################################
00073 inline bool Point2DT::isValid() const
00074 {
00075   return p.i != -1 && p.j != -1;
00076 }
